 Problem Description:

 A vulnerability has been discovered and corrected in openldap:
 
 The rwm overlay in OpenLDAP 2.4.23, 2.4.36, and earlier does not
 properly count references, which allows remote attackers to cause
 a denial of service (slapd crash) by unbinding immediately after a
 search request, which triggers rwm_conn_destroy to free the session
 context while it is being used by rwm_op_search (CVE-2013-4449).
 
 The updated packages have been patched to correct this issue.
